    NES Fircroft are working with a large engineering client based in Sheffield who are looking for an Electrical & Automation Engineer.


    The Role
    This is an exciting opportunity for an Electrical and Automation Engineer to join a small team in playing an important role in the delivering of complex product solutions throughout the full product lifecycle.


    Working as a member of the engineering team providing an engineering service for the company, responsible for the electrical / automation engineering of a specific portion of a product or project.
    Project responsibilities include productivity, technical output quality, resource control, progress, product standardisation, health and safety and compliance.
    This role will report to the Engineering Service Manager – Downstream and will have regular contact with colleagues from all functional areas of the business.
    You will have enthusiasm, be customer focused, results oriented and have a positive and solution-oriented attitude.

    Main Tasks and Responsibilities:

    • Specifying the electrical, instrumentation and control requirements for mechanical / fluids equipment on projects
    • Produce technically compliant and cost-effective design documentation; drawings, specifications, calculations, manuals etc. for a specific area/equipment and meet project requirements and company operating procedures / statutory obligations.
    • Ensure that the design and documentation of electrical equipment is produced to the required standards, within budget and agreed time scales.
    • Work with the engineering manager / lead engineer as the technical focus for a specific portion of a project ensuring a successful and commercially viable contract execution. This would include reporting budgets, progress and change management.
    • Report to the lead engineer and/or departmental manager on all matters relating to the project.
    • Provide technical support to ensure that equipment is manufactured, tested, installed and commissioned in accordance with the design and operational requirements, either from the office or at site
    • Develop, maintain and cultivate relationships with Clients, Suppliers, Sub Contractors to ensure successful execution of the project, future business.
    • Site support and commissioning of some products and equipment on clients sites.



    Skills and Experiences

    • Ability to solve problems quickly and positively. Take an active part in the decision making of the engineering team.
    • Experience of project engineering and the project lifecycle from sales through to installation & commissioning from a specific electrical / automation engineering view.
    • Strong ability within machine design and instrumentation
    • Sizing and application of motors to optimise machine design
    • Knowledge of safety systems for industrial control
    • Proficient user of Eplan
    • Ability to communicate at all levels on both technical and non-technical issues
    • Working knowledge of Health and Safety legislation and requirements
    • Must be self-motivated and proficient in time management with the ability to multi-task and set priorities for self and others
    • An understanding of Project Management, Planning, Procurement, Sales and R&D disciplines is desirable.
    • Exposure to different cultures from around the world leading to sensitivity towards those differing cultures (desirable)
